This function isn't exported in the standard Ruby headers,
it returns an aggregate value and isn't available in Rubinius,
either, so nuke it.

While we're at it, use clock_gettime() instead of gettimeofday()
to avoid unnecessary timeval usage since mq_send/mq_receive
rely on higher-precision timespecs instead.
